			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>On Queens Birthday weekend (2-4th June 2007) we will be having the Inaugural Ride &amp; Climb weekend. A group of no more than 6 people will be taken by mountain bike through some 30Kms of backcountry roads in the area to the famed Maunganui Bluff where they will be invited to climb the 480m Bluff and get unbelievable views up and down the Endless Beach.</p>
<p>The guests for this weekend ride will arrive on Friday night, be fed a lovely home made meal using local produce, and be accommodated in either double or twin rooms.</p>
<p>A route briefing will take place before heading off in the morning with a packed lunch and plenty of energy from the breakfast provided.</p>
<p>The ride will be on virtually unused back roads around the area to the Maunganui Bluff. There are all types of terrain for the riders to content with <!--[if gte vml 1]&amp;gt;                                                  --><!--[if !vml]--> <img src='http://s0.wp.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_smile.gif' alt=':)' class='wp-smiley' /> <!--[endif]-->, the majority of the ride will be easy to moderate although there are a couple of long uphill parts (and downhill &#8211; as well).</p>
<p>Once at the Maunganui Bluff there are two options &#8211; climb the Bluff or go down to play on the longest beach in New Zealand.</p>
<p>The climb up the Bluff is steep and long &#8211; it takes approx 1 hour to climb the 480m to get to the top. Amazing views reward the climber, and this is the perfect place for a picnic lunch.</p>
<p>The beach is also an unspoilt expanse of clean golden sand. At low tide mussels can be picked from the rocks below the Bluff for an entree at the evening meal. <!--[if gte vml 1]&amp;gt;   --><!--[if !vml]--> <img src='http://s0.wp.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_smile.gif' alt=':)' class='wp-smiley' /> <!--[endif]--></p>
<p>Then there is the ride back to the farm for a well-earned shower and maybe a quick lie down before dinner.</p>
<p>The following day can be lazy or another local ride can be taken to enjoy the countryside and the amazing views. Perhaps a swim in the fresh water Kai Iwi lakes, or a trip to Trounson Forest to see the Kauri trees and the Kiwi at night.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>This winter has been very wet here in Northland. The paddocks are very wet and soft in places. At least we still have plenty of grass for our animals. There are some in the area who have mud &#8211; no grass. Those farmers have overstocked though, and have been forced to feed out every day. Perhaps in the summer I might put some crushed rock around the gates to reduce the pugging caused by the animals wandering between the paddocks.</p>
<p>Jenny seems to think that the Kunekune&#8217;s are pregnant. We will need to wait and see &#8211; somewhere around end of September she reckons. It would be good if they are &#8211; it is a long time since we had some piglets around.</p>
<p>Come September we will be borrowing a bull to service our 4 cows. With a bit of luck we may have some calves at hoof next year.</p>
<p>At least with all the rain the streams in our bush are working well. The bush has recharged its water levels since the very hot weather we had last summer and are expecting again this summer. After the extreme heat in Europe this year we are told by the climatologists that we can expect the same. Time will tell.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<pre>Are you sure that you want to come in July? That is our
winter here. Although we are in Northland where it is
semi-tropical it is wet during that period. Not really the
best time for camping, although the forests and beaches are
quite breathtaking.

Our hostel is small and has beds for 18 people in 7 rooms.
We have 14 acres of land here, with 6 acres in grass and the
balance in bush. We have animals - cows, sheep, kunekune
pigs, chickens, a dog and some cats. We have plenty of room
for camping.

In the hostel itself we have 3 showers, 3 seperate toilets,
a laundry, a lounge (with board games and books - NO TV), a
dining room, fully equipped kitchen, outside BBQ area (under
cover) and a raised veranda just for sitting and enjoying
the peace and quiet. You wake to the bush chorus and fall
asleep after your night walk to see the glow worms in our
bush. Overall, a place to relax and recharge the batteries.

Close by we have the Kai Iwi lakes - these are fresh water
lakes near the beach. They are stocked with trout so fishing
is a possibility, whereas swimming is definately on. We are
approx 11kms from the longest beach in New Zealand - it is
120kms long, and can be used as a road at low tide (although
this is not recommended <img src='http://s0.wp.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_smile.gif' alt=':)' class='wp-smiley' /> ). We have two Kauri Forest parks
very close. Trouson Kauri Park is 7 Kms away, easily
accessible by vehicle or foot. This park is classed as a
"Mainland island", where the park is breeding Kiwi's in a
natural habitat and keeping down the pests (such as rats, mice, feral cats,
weasals, possums, etc). They are very succesful and on a
night walk there is a 50/50 chance of seeing Kiwi's in the
forest. The Waipoua forest is 20kms away along the main
highway. It is here that the largest kauri tree (Tane
Manhuta) is. There are many 1/2 day and full day walks
through this forest. Lastly there is the beach where a walk
to the top of the Maunganui Bluff (3 hours) will reward you
with amazing views along the coastline. There are also walks
along the beach to the lakes, mussel gathering at low tide,
and mullet fishing on the incoming tide (at another beach).

As you can see there is a lot to do in this immediate area
using our hostel as a base.

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><font color="#0000ff" face="Arial" size="2">New Zealand in the South Island in the winter is bitterly cold. In the last two weeks the areas around Christchurch have had heaps of snow. Last night was -3deg C and the days high was 8 deg C. Normally they don&#39;t get a lot of snow. There are places in the South Island that have been without power for 10 days because of the snow. Sheep are stranded and the farmers can&#39;t get to them and are leaving them to die.</font></p>
<p><font color="#0000ff"><font size="2"><font face="Arial">Use of the YHA hostels may be a problem because there are not a lot in New Zealand. The biggest group of backpackers hostels are the BBH hostels. Info can be found at<font color="#000000">  </font><font color="#0000ff"><a href="http://www.backpack.co.nz/" title="BBH Hostels">www.backpack.co.nz</a></font></font><font color="#000000" face="Arial"><font color="#0000ff"> . If they get to the North Island  we</font> <font color="#0000ff">have a backpackers at Kaihu which is in Northland. The name is Kaihu Farm. If the boys want to go into the skiing areas then they need to make sure that they book ahead for accommodation, and they won&#39;t be cheap.</font></font></font></font></p>
<p><font size="2"><font color="#0000ff"><font face="Arial">Passenger trains in New Zealand are not very frequent or even that many. They have been described as an endangered species by a UK travel writer. The tourist routes still exist but there are only a few of them. If they are backpacking the best bus service is the Magic Bus which picks up and drops off at backpackers hostel in a circular route. There website is<!--StartFragment -->  <a href="http://www.magicbus.co.nz/" title="Backpackers transport">www.magicbus.co.nz</a>. They are also the best  priced. </font></font></font></p>
<p><font color="#0000ff" face="Arial" size="2">To get from the South Island to the North Island they will need to catch the ferry at Picton and they will arrive at Wellington. There is a train service from Wellington to Auckland, but it only runs at night. This service goes through the most spectacular country that you can&#39;t see any other way, but now they only run at night they won&#39;t see it. The other option is a coach service. Whatever they choose they must realise that although the distance on a map isn&#39;t very far it takes a long time to actually get anywhere. The trip from Wellington to Auckland is 400 miles, but it takes between 10 -12 hours to make the trip either by road or train. Air flight takes an hour.</font></p>
<p><font color="#0000ff" face="Arial" size="2">There isn&#39;t anything special they need to be concerned about. The Kiwi&#39;s are friendly people and will help if asked. There are always the rat bags who will steal and try to cheat you, so you need your wits about you.</font></p>
<p><font color="#0000ff" face="Arial" size="2">There is much to see in New Zealand. It has been described as the whole of Europe rolled into a smaller package. This is true &#8211; we have the amazing countryside, but not a lot of grand buildings. Take plenty of photographs and keep a travel diary. Instead of trying to do the whole of New Zealand in a short time, they probably need to look on this as the first visit where they have a whistle stop tour, and then come back later for a more detailed stay in places of interest. The real New Zealand is in the country, not the cities.</font></p>
